A Russian soldier captured in October 2024, identified as Sergei Skobelev of the 22nd Regiment of the Guards Separate Marine Brigade, has been identified as having personally executed four Ukrainian POWs with an AK-74 assault rifle in Kursk Oblast.
Multiple high-reliability sources confirm the core facts of this event.

Skobelev personally shot four Ukrainian servicemen with an AK-74 assault rifle
According to the analytical project DeepState, which cites sources in the 1st Separate Tank Brigade, the Russian military shot nine Ukrainian soldiers in the Kursk region on October 10.
The shootings are said to have occurred on Oct. 10, the crowd-sourced monitoring group Deepstate reported on Oct. 13, citing sources in Ukraine's First Tank Brigade.
Nine Ukrainian POWs were shot by Russian troops in Kursk region after surrendering
On October 10, Russian forces shot nine Ukrainian drone operators and support personnel in the Zelenyi Put area of Kursk Oblast.
